Выгрузка заказов: отбор по ID, типу плательщика, свойству и arrFilter

Рейтинг: 4.4510  
Новая
Предложил Пользователь 25773 16.03.2022 00:19:30

Выгрузка заказов: отбор по ID, типу плательщика, свойству и arrFilter

В обмене заказами очень сильно не хватает отборов, какие заказы выгружать в 1С.

В стандартные условия предлагаю добавить:

1. ID заказа начиная с которого выгружать. Если у клиента старый сайт и новая 1С, на сайте очень много заказов и старые он не хочет убирать в архив, то надо запретить выгружать старые, например явно указав ID начиная с которых нужно.

2. Типы плательщиков, заказы которых выгружать. Типичная задача: для Физических лиц выгружать на ИП, для юридических лиц на ООО. Или выгружать в разные базы 1С.

3. Было бы хорошо иметь свойство по которому заказы бы выгружались в 1С. Надо добавить настройку: код свойства и значение свойства, чтобы проверялось при выгрузке. Это нужно разработчику если нужна особая логика для того, чтобы заказ можно было выгружать. Или чтобы распределить выгрузки по разным выгрузкам. Например по городу магазина

4. Для других частных случаев предлагаю еще добавить в компонент выгрузки заказов arrFilter чтобы можно было бы и свои условия дописывать.